How they compare
Southern Africa currently reports 3,939 kt against 2,327 kt in Qatar, a difference of 1,612 kt.
That makes Southern Africa's figure about 1.7 times Qatar's.
Across all 34 years both countries report, Southern Africa has been ahead every year.
Qatar ranks 41st and Southern Africa ranks 31st of 219 countries.
Southern Africa has averaged higher in every one of the 4 decades both report.

About this data
The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
